Orthopedic Surgical Robots Market Report by Hip, Knee, and Spine Surgery

The global orthopedic surgical robots market was valued at USD 743.3 million in 2023 and is projected to reach USD 1,093.5 million by 2030, expanding at a CAGR of 5.7% from 2024 to 2030. Market growth is primarily driven by the rising volume of knee and hip replacement procedures, the entry of new players into the healthcare robotics landscape, and continuous improvements in clinical outcomes enabled by robotic-assisted surgery.

The increasing incidence of osteoarthritis in developed economies is significantly contributing to the growing demand for joint replacement surgeries. According to data published by the World Health Organization in July 2022, approximately 1.71 billion people worldwide are affected by musculoskeletal disorders, including 528 million individuals living with osteoarthritis. These trends are accelerating the adoption of robotic technologies that enhance surgical precision, reduce recovery time, and improve patient outcomes.

Further driving market growth is the rising prevalence of musculoskeletal conditions such as lower back pain, rheumatoid arthritis, osteoarthritis, and osteoporosis. In the United States alone, musculoskeletal disorders account for nearly 70 million physician office visits annually, along with approximately 130 million total healthcare encounters, including outpatient, inpatient, and emergency room visits. Additionally, data from the Australian Bureau of Statistics 2020–21 National Health Survey indicate that 27.0% of the Australian population suffers from chronic musculoskeletal conditions, including back problems (16%), arthritis (12%), and osteoporosis or osteopenia (3.6%).

Key Market Trends & Insights

  • North America was the largest revenue-generating regional market in 2023.
  • On a country level, Saudi Arabia is expected to register the highest CAGR from 2024 to 2030.
  • By application, the knee segment dominated the market with a 43.3% revenue share in 2023.
  • The spine segment is projected to be the most lucrative, registering the fastest growth during the forecast period.

Competitive Landscape

The orthopedic surgical robots market is characterized by rapid technological innovation, strategic partnerships, and increasing investments aimed at expanding robotic-assisted surgical capabilities.

  • In February 2024, THINK Surgical, Inc. announced a collaboration with Maxx Orthopedics. Through this partnership, Maxx Orthopedics implants will be integrated with the TMINI™ Miniature Robotic System, supporting an open-platform approach for orthopedic robotic surgery.
  • In November 2023, Monogram Orthopaedics Inc. announced the delivery of its first surgical robot to the global market. The company aims to enhance orthopedic joint replacement procedures through next-generation robotic technologies.
  • In August 2023, Stryker Corporation launched a direct-to-patient marketing campaign focused on joint replacement procedures. The initiative was designed to improve patient education, increase engagement, and empower individuals to make informed healthcare decisions, ultimately enhancing treatment outcomes.
